It is conceivable that the focus of telemedicine technology is the elderly, underserved people and their caregivers, people with chronic diseases, family members and employees, and fitness-oriented people. The implementation of telemedicine is expanding worldwide. This can be attributed to its ability to enhance the nature of care, reach out to patients in the rural network, reduce hospitalizations and readmissions, increase patient participation, and improve time management and accommodation. In addition, telemedicine has solved the global shortage of doctors. The increase in the prevalence of chronic diseases, the increase in the elderly population and the increase in the cost of medical care services are the factors driving this market. Up to now, mHealth (mobile health) is considered to be the most used telemedicine. With a wide variety of multifunctional health applications and new customer-friendly mobile treatment devices on the market, patients currently rely on technology to screen and track their health.

Telemedicine has made great strides in communication innovation to enable healthcare professionals to provide financially proficient and effective healthcare, distance learning for patients, supervision, reduction of waste and physical appointment requirements, and improvement of the time proficiency of healthcare professionals Degree etc. Generally speaking, the integration of the medical system and the reduction of the shortage of medical experts worldwide are another aspect of innovation. The driving factors of the telemedicine market include increased demand for medical care services in rural areas, increased measures taken by the government to meet the health needs of the rural population, advanced information technology infrastructure, and an increase in the number of telemedicine service providers.

On the other hand, the lack of reimbursement, management problems, lack of doctor’s knowledge and recognition, poor connection, high installation costs, and poor network quality in underdeveloped areas, especially in emerging countries around the world, lack of awareness are some constraints on the expansion of the telemedicine market. aspect.

In 2016, GlobalMed accepted TreatMD. TreatMD has helped GlobalMed connect with doctors and patients around the world. It is believed that the transaction will create synergy between TreatMD's direct-to-customer telemedicine technology and the GlobalMed telemedicine technology established between customers. In the same year, Medvivo, one of the well-known telemedicine companies, took over Expert 24. Its main goal was to expand its regional distribution and product lines throughout the United States, Europe and the United Kingdom.

In November 2017, BioTelemetry, Inc. reported its contract with Apple Inc. to allow the provision of cardiac monitoring services based on the Apple Heart Research. Also in the same period, Telcare (a division of BioTelemetry) was the world's first manufacturer of cellular glucose monitors authorized by the FDA, and established a strategic partnership with Onduo, which was established by Sanofi and Verily (a company Alphabet company). In the combined joint venture, Telcare is considered the provider of the remote blood glucose system and provides follow-up data to patients recruited by Onduo's pioneering diabetes management program.

In addition to the growth of teleclinical companies, increasing the number of virtual medical centers are some trends found in the global telemedicine market. In rural areas, the shortage of doctors is considered to bring new prospects for the expansion of the global telemedicine market. Some well-known companies operating in the global telemedicine market are AMD Telemedicine, Philips Healthcare, Cardio Net Inc. McKesson Ltd., and GE Healthcare Ltd.. Given the growing potential of developing countries (such as Russia and Brazil), the most important market players are focusing on increasing services in these regions.
